You can attach images to a work order's "Work to Perform" or "Completion Form" form. Both forms, including pictures, will be part of the work order PDF, which can be included in the invoice PDF. For more information about attaching an image to a work order, please see the Attach Images to a Work Order subsection.
By default, however, you cannot attach pictures or documents to an invoice. However, this action can be requested as a feature. Please contact our Sales Team at Sales@mobiwork.com for more information.
You can update the way that MobiWork keeps tracks of invoices through your Invoice Settings page.
To make changes, access the Edit Settings pop-up from the General Settings section. In this pop-up window, use the drop-down field for "Invoice Number Type" to enter the new numbering sequence for your invoices:

You can use the following options to organize your invoices:
- The MobiWork ID.
- A custom sequence with a prefix, start number, and suffix (which will increment by one),
- Or you can enter the digits manually (where the user enters the invoice number). The Manual option still assigns each invoice a unique MobiWork ID, but also allows you to give the invoice a custom number in the "Invoice Number" field.

The Caution Sign icon displayed on the Invoices "List" tab indicates overdue invoices with unpaid balances (this includes partially paid payments). This icon appears for any invoice with a remaining balance greater than $0.00:

MobiWork enables you to close and complete invoices or work orders regardless of the balance, even those with a balance of $0.00.

When invoices are linked to the corresponding work order, you will be able to see the work order number (and a link directing you the work order) in the View Work Order pop-up window:

Multiple work order IDs can be shown in this view.
If the invoice is exported to PDF, a column will display the corresponding work order ID:

The "Description" field contains the supporting text that provides additional details about the invoice and work order. This information is displayed in View Invoice pop-up window, the Customer Preview and the generated Invoice PDF that can be sent to the customer:

Depending on how your settings are set up, the description can populate differently.
When editing an invoice, you can manually enter or modify the description in the "Description" field.
If the invoice is generated from a work order, the "Description" field can be configured to automatically populate the work order description or the Work Order Completed Form's comments.
Please note that for the "Description" field to populate automatically, the corresponding information must already exist. For example, if the description is configured to use the Work Order Completion Form's comments, the work order must first be completed and the completion form must have text, in order for the corresponding description to appear on the invoice.
On the Invoice Settings page, you can choose which option fits your business better. Click on the Pencil icon in the "General" panel to edit the "Invoice Description Pre-population:"

You can choose to:
Automatically populate with the Work Order Description
Automatically populate with the Work Order Completion Form Comment
Remain blank and require manual entry.
These options help streamline invoice creation while ensuring that relevant job details are accurately reflected on customer-facing documents.
